Recent snowfall has created fresh slabs that can be easily triggered on most steep slopes. Most avalanches will be small but could grow large enough to bury or kill you in wind-drifted areas at higher elevations. The threat of triggering a larger avalanche that steps deeper into the snowpack remains. Low-angle slopes less than about 30 degrees without steep slopes above offer the safest riding options. Even small avalanches can knock you off your feet or machine, drag you into trees, or bury you deeply in a gulley.
